Leakage of ammonia gas and ammonia absorbing power of sprayed water.

Summary
This paper describes the test results on the leakage velocity of ammonia gas and the absorbing power of sprayed water. Since ammonia is somewhat toxic, the authors established how to remove the ammonia in the air for safe use. The tests showed that the leakage velocity could be expressed using pressure and the leakage area, and the absorbing power of sprayed water could be expressed as the ammonia concentration of the space.
